Sorry !! No Content here.

How to Buy Gemstones Online?
Categories
Tags
lab-created diamondsartificial gemspinel gemaquamarine gemstonessynthetic emeraldemerald gemstonealexandrite stoneblue gemstonesamethyst stone meaningmoissanitegemstones for saleartificial sapphiregarnet gemstonegray moonstonekyanitelab grown sapphiregreen amethyst stonebirthstones by monthbirthstonesbirthstones for each month